The Environmental Health And Safety
The Environmental Health & Safety Office (EH&S) is responsible for development and maintenance of a safe working environment for the students, faculty, staff and visitors at the University of Texas at El Paso. As part of their task, they identify and evaluate health and safety risks on campus and recommend methods to eliminate or abate those risks, assuring University compliance with applicable laws and regulations.
All members of NanoFabrication Facility are encouraged to visit EH&S website to review safety manuals and policies, sign up for training or access the SDS database.
